Ushuru Sacco, originally known as Customs & Excise Workers (CUEW) Sacco, was formed in 1970 to serve employees of the Customs & Excise Department under the Ministry of Finance. In 1995, after the formation of the Kenya Revenue Authority (KRA), the Sacco rebranded to Ushuru Sacco in 2002 to reflect its inclusive membership base, which now includes employees from both public and private institutions across Kenya.
With an asset base of Ksh 6.12 billion, Ushuru Sacco is one of the largest deposit-taking Saccos in Kenya, providing a wide range of financial products and services to its members.
Ushuru Sacco Membership Eligibility
Membership at Ushuru Sacco is open to all resident and non-resident Kenyans, regardless of their location. To qualify for membership, an individual must meet the following criteria:
- Be at least 18 years of age.
- Be an ordinary resident of Kenya.
- Have a clean record, without any criminal conviction involving fraud or dishonesty.
- Not be a member of any similar savings and credit cooperative society.
- Be within the field of membership, which includes employees of KRA, government ministries, reputable private companies, and organizations, or a spouse of an existing member.
- Not engage in activities such as money lending that may conflict with the Sacco’s objectives.
- Be of good character.
Ushuru Sacco Membership Requirements
To join Ushuru Sacco, applicants need to meet the following requirements:
- Completed membership application form: This can be downloaded from the Ushuru Sacco website or collected at any of the Sacco’s branches.
- A copy of the National ID.
- One passport-sized photograph.
- Entrance fee of Kshs 1,000.
- Share capital of Kshs 30,000.
- Monthly savings of Kshs 3,000.
- Rejoining fee (if applicable): Kshs 3,000.
- Risk Management Fund (RMF) contribution: Kshs 300 per month.
Benefits of Ushuru Sacco Membership
As a member of Ushuru Sacco, you gain access to various benefits that enhance your financial stability and growth:
- Fast Loan Processing: Ushuru Sacco offers a loan turnaround time of 48 hours or less, ensuring quick access to funds when needed.
- Convenient Banking Solutions: Members can access services 24/7 through alternative channels such as mobile banking, the online member portal, and the Sacco Link debit card.
- Mobile-based Loans: Members can apply for quick loans via their mobile phones, with amounts of up to Kshs 150,000.
- Diverse Loan Products: Ushuru Sacco provides an array of loan products, including emergency loans, development loans, school fees loans, and more.
- Savings and Investment Opportunities: Members can benefit from competitive dividends on shares and other savings products.
